Discover  your Audience 

Who your customers are?

If you do not understand the needs and wants of your target market, it is impossible to improve the CX. But how exactly would you come to know about that? 

There needs to be a deep understanding of the existing customer base and their needs by creating a buyer’s persona. You can start to create it with the help of some parameters such as: 

  •  their demographic info (gender, age, location, etc.)
  •  their professional background, and 
  • what makes your customer happy and satisfied?

Discovering the needs and expectations of customers will aid you in defining a plan to build a well-rounded strategy.

Create a competitor Analysis

Researching your competitors’ current CX practices will keep you informed. This helps to understand your customers in a much better way by comparing the responses of customers’ products and services with your competitors and optimizing them accordingly.

Here is how you can do the analysis:

  • Carry out research
  • Accumulate competitive information
  • Analyze competitive information
  • Discover your competitive position

From the analysis, you will be able to identify gaps between competitors and their customer’s strengths and weaknesses This helps to understand what is working for your competitors and where they are lacking so that you can take the first mover advantage there. Use these insights to make more streamlined processes internally and helps to perceive how you can build your strategy.
